The No. 11 Arizona State Sun Devils (23-10), 4.5-point underdogs, take on the No. 6 Buffalo Bulls (31-3) in the First Round of the NCAA Tournament at Bank of Oklahoma Center. The game’s Over/Under (O/U) has been set at 157 points and action gets underway at 4 p.m. ET on Friday, March 22, 2019.

Arizona State Sun Devils vs. Buffalo Bulls ATS Odds

Both teams beat their last opponent. The Bulls defeated the Bowling Green Falcons 87-73, while the Sun Devils beat the No. 11 St. John’s Red Storm 74-65.

The Sun Devils knocked down 25 of their 33 free throws (75.8 percent) and held the Red Storm to an effective field goal percentage of 0.377 (below their season average of 0.523). The Bulls, meanwhile, made 16 of their 21 free throws (76.2 percent) and held the Falcons to an effective field goal percentage of 0.444 (below their season average of 0.509). Jeremy Harris had a good outing for Buffalo, contributing 31 points and five rebounds. Arizona State was led by Zylan Cheatham, who had 14 points and 10 rebounds.

Vegas has a tendency to place the total high when the Sun Devils are involved, as 60.6 percent of their contests have finished under the total. Arizona State heads into the contest with records of 23-10 straight up (SU) and 18-14-1 against the spread (ATS).

There does not appear to be a trend for Bulls games in regards to the total, as there has been an even split between games finishing over and under. Further, Buffalo is 31-3 SU and 18-13-1 ATS.

There should be plenty of transition offense in this contest that showcases two of the NCAA’s more up-tempo teams. Buffalo ranks 17th in possessions per game (74.1) and Arizona State is 43rd (72.5).
